CAIRO – Director of the Center for Middle East Studies Abdel Rahim Ali said Thursday that Daesh has $3 billion in secret bank accounts.

The terrorist organization, he said, will use this money in financing its terrorist activities in other countries after the defeats it sustained in both Syria and Iraq.

He added at a seminar on the financing of terrorist organizations in French capital Paris that it is important for world governments to think of how they will fight the remnants of such terrorist organizations.

He faulted the French government in hosting the state of Qatar, a world terrorism-sponsor, to an international conference now held in Paris on terrorism financing.

He said Qatar has presence in Somalia, hoping to turn the resource-poor African state into an identical copy of Afghanistan and an incubator for terrorist groups.

Saudi Arabi and the United Arab Emirates, he said, made efforts to develop Somalia.

Nonetheless, he said, these efforts were hampered by Qatar.

He said Qatar and other world terrorism-sponsors will work hard in the future to ensure that Somalia will turn into a meeting point for world terrorists.

The seminar is organized by the Center for Middle East Studies. It is held simultaneously with an international conference in the French capital on the financing of terrorism.

French President Emmanuel Macron attends the international conference, along with a large number of terrorism experts and government representatives.
